Program understanding is the (ill-defined) deductive process of acquiring knowledge about a software artifact through analysis, abstraction, and generalization. This report identifies some of the emerging technologies in program understanding. We present technical capabilities currently under development that may be of significant benefit to practitioners within five years. Three areas of work are explored: investigating cognitive aspects, developing support mechanisms, and maturing the practice.
